Pet adoption really is an awesome thing that I would strongly encourage. Some of the sweetest pets I've ever come across were rescued from shelters, like those run by the SPCA. It is a common misconception that all stray dogs are mutts. There are a lot of pure bred dogs that are in need of a good home. All you have to do is pick up the phone and call your nearest pet rescue to figure that one out. Shelter and rescue dogs go through an extensive evaluation period to see if they are suitable for adoption. They are tested for food aggression, dog aggression, and how friendly they are with children among other metrics. Pet adoption is a fairly efficient way to find a well balanced family dog. |
